Outdoor learning encompasses many different experiences in the outdoors: from visits, residential and PE outdoors to Forest School. In fact, any experience outdoors that allows children to engage and learn in a different way. Outdoor Learning can help to bring many school subjects alive as they focus on real results and consequences. For that reason the outdoors can have an impact on areas of the curriculum as diverse as imaginative writing and learning about the environment. Outdoor learning also provides experiential opportunities allowing pupils to respond positively to opportunities, challenges and responsibilities, to manage risk and to cope with change.
The positive benefits to children’s emotional health and well-being mean that at Gresham Village School and Nursery all children from Nursery to Year 6 receive dedicated Outdoor Learning and Forest School sessions as part of their school timetable.
